Why it stands out
The 2020 Nissan Altima stands out as a midsize family sedan that gets a lot right without having a single defining gimmick. It was redesigned the year before, and for 2020 Nissan made its Safety Shield 360 advanced driver-assistance package more widely available, making it optional on the base S trim and standard on SR and higher. That gives the Altima a stronger safety story than before, while its easy-to-use technology, multiple powertrain options, and great handling help it remain a well-rounded choice.
At the same time, the Altima is not without drawbacks. The available safety equipment is not standard across the lineup, and the car is described as poor value for money. Even so, it appeals to buyers who want a comfortable sedan with good fuel efficiency, a smooth ride, and a generous feature set, especially in the base model.

What should I look for when buying a used 2020 Nissan Altima?
At 60.5% accident-free, a meaningful share of listings has prior incidents — history verification is especially important.
You should start with a vehicle history report and then prioritize a pre-purchase inspection, especially if you are considering a higher-mileage or lower-priced example. Pay close attention to body condition, panel alignment, tire wear, and signs that safety equipment or driver-assistance features may not be functioning as intended.
Key things to evaluate:
- Trim level: The lineup includes base S, sporty SR, SV, SL, and Platinum trims. The base trim misses some safety equipment that becomes standard on higher versions, so you should compare feature content carefully before assuming all trims are similarly equipped.
- Powertrain: Most versions use a 2.5-liter 4-cylinder engine with up to 188 horsepower and a CVT, while SR and Platinum can be had with the VC-Turbo 2.0-liter engine. AWD is available with the 2.5-liter setup, but not with the turbo engine.
- Safety package: Nissan Safety Shield 360 includes forward collision warning and automatic emergency braking on the base S, while higher trims add pedestrian detection, blind-spot warning, rear cross-traffic warning, lane departure warning, rear automatic braking, and automatic high-beam assistance. Those added features are optional on the S.
- Infotainment: The Altima uses an 8-inch display and includes Bluetooth, a text-messaging assistant, Siri Eyes Free, Apple CarPlay, and Android Auto. Available upgrades include satellite radio, navigation, a 9-speaker Bose audio system, and Nissan Connect Services.
- Fuel efficiency: The VC-Turbo engine is rated at 29 mpg in combined driving.
Which 2020 Nissan Altima trim should I buy?
The 2020 Nissan Altima is offered in 5 trim levels: S, SR, SV, SL, Platinum.
Here's the short version:
- S: This is the value-focused starting point, and it makes the Altima’s easy-to-use tech and comfortable everyday character accessible at the lowest level. It is the trim to consider if you want the basics done well and plan to shop carefully for a good deal.
- SR: This trim adds the sportier character in the lineup and is the first step where the more advanced safety package becomes standard. It is the best-value trim if you want a stronger mix of equipment and safety without moving all the way upmarket.
- SV: This is the sensible middle choice if you want a more balanced feature set than the S without paying for the top trims. It suits you if comfort and convenience matter more than appearance upgrades.
- SL: This trim moves the Altima closer to a more premium-feeling daily driver, with more comfort and convenience content. It makes sense if you want a nicer cabin and are willing to pay for it.
- Platinum: This is the most upscale version and is the right pick if you want the fullest feature set and the most polished presentation. It also pairs with the available turbocharged engine for shoppers who want the strongest performance option.
Safety-package note: the full Nissan Safety Shield 360 suite is standard on SR and higher, while the base S gets only part of it unless you add the optional equipment.

Is the 2020 Nissan Altima safe?
The 2020 Nissan Altima earns a five-star overall rating from NHTSA and a Top Safety Pick rating from IIHS.
It earns an 8/10 safety score from our experts.
Nissan Safety Shield 360 is the key driver-assistance suite here, and it includes forward collision warning, automatic emergency braking, pedestrian detection, blind-spot warning, rear cross-traffic warning, lane departure warning, rear automatic braking, and automatic high-beam assistance. On the base S trim, only part of that package is standard, while the rest is optional.
The main caveat is that the advanced safety equipment is not standard on every trim, so you should verify exactly what is installed on any used example you are considering. The expert review also notes that ProPilot Assist can be irritating and hard to trust in some situations, so it is best viewed as a convenience feature rather than a reason to buy.
